CBN to clear backlog of dollar demand via special SMIS
The CBN announced a special Secondary Market Intervention Sale to clear a backlog of matured FX obligations through a multiple-price book building process for Raw materials and Machineries, Agriculture, Airlines and Petroleum Products. The FX obligations for Petroleum Products must have matured before September 30, 2016. The apex bank also stated that Authorised Dealers’ accounts will be debited in full for the Naira equivalent of the dollar bid amount on a spot basis, whilst the CBN will settle the bids through forward settlements of 2 months. We highlight that the naira has strengthened in the parallel market given the sustained intervention by the CBN in the FX market and we believe the currency could maintain this momentum given the improved market liquidity.
DANGCEM singlehandedly pulls NSE ASI under water
The Nigerian Bourse continued its bearish start to the month of March, declining much steeper this time (NSE ASI down 140bps) as sharp sell-offs in market heavyweight DANGCEM upturned gains across other key sectors. We expect the market to bounce back at week close supported by improved investment sentiment across a number of market blue chips.
Stock Watch: Despite announcing a y/y PAT growth of 23% and a final dividend of ₦1.77, ZENITHBANK has been under significant sell pressure, shedding 600bps since the announcement date.We however highlight the modest improvement in the dividend yield – 13% vs. 12% at announcement and could be better given sustained weakness in the stock. Closure date is slated for March 13, 2017.
Bearish sentiment persists amidst thin system liquidity
Considering the persistent liquidity mop up and with market participants anticipating CBN Secondary Market Intervention Sales, we anticipate muted buying interest in the fixed income space in the coming session.
